Meanings

noun

  1. 1.A brief or cursory look.
  2. 2.A deflection.
  3. 3.A stroke in which the ball is deflected to one side.
  4. 4.A sudden flash of light or splendour.
  5. 5.An incidental or passing thought or allusion.

verb

  1. 1.To look briefly (at something).
  2. 2.To graze a surface.
  3. 3.To sparkle.
  4. 4.To move quickly, appearing and disappearing rapidly; to be visible only for an instant at a time; to move interruptedly; to twinkle.
  5. 5.To strike and fly off in an oblique direction; to dart aside.
